## Env Vars: Seatwright Renderer

The Seatwright renderer draws seat maps for the Follervane Theatre booking site. Required vars: SEATWRIGHT_VENUE_ID, SEATWRIGHT_CACHE_DIR, SEATWRIGHT_MAX_ZOOM. Optional: SEATWRIGHT_DEBUG_GRID for layout work. All vars go in render.env; the service reads it once at startup, so restart after edits. The renderer also fetches live availability from the box-office API, which needs an auth credential. Add this line to render.env:

vault entry, yajop-bafop: ARCHIVE_KEY3=8d4

Welcome to the Stridemark timing crew! Our chip readers sit at the start, split, and finish mats of the Kellerbrook Marathon and stream reads to the Pacewire ingest service. From a security angle, the interesting bit is that each reader signs its payloads before they leave the device, so spoofed finish times get rejected upstream. When you flash a reader for review, the provisioning script reads its signing credential from the local env file, which needs this line:

env line for fafof-fahag: LEDGER_TOKEN5=f8790

## Changelog — Brickforge migration, defaults changed

Ferrox build pipeline now runs under Brickforge hermetic builds. Network access disabled during compile. Toolchain pinned; system headers no longer leak in. Cache keys changed — expect one slow cold build per host. Old `make` wrappers removed. If a rebuild fails tonight, don't roll back; re-trigger with the hermetic flag. The new default configuration values are listed below.

service settings:
[ulair]
team = praath
access_code = ac_06d704
owner = wenix.ulair
host = ulair.qirvancorp.corp
port = 9200
peer = sorys.nelvronet.internal
salt = 2668132c
pin = 9140

## Breaker config — Ordino upstream

Reviewers: confirm the circuit breaker wrapping the Ordino pricing API opens after 5 consecutive failures, holds open for 30 seconds, and half-opens with a single probe request. Verify the fallback returns cached quotes no older than 10 minutes, and that breaker state transitions emit metrics to the Pell dashboard. Before approving the deploy, check that the manifest is signed with the current release key, reproduced here.

rollout seal: bky9_PeXH1fTLY